The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) 2025 NextGen initiatives aim to enhance the national airspace system in significant ways. The primary focus of these efforts is to improve safety, increase capacity, and reduce environmental impact through the implementation of cutting-edge technologies and innovative airspace management strategies. Key aspects of these initiatives include:
- Performance-Based Navigation (PBN): PBN utilizes satellite-based navigation systems and tailored flight procedures to enhance aircraft navigation accuracy and efficiency.
- Automatic Dependent Surveillance-Broadcast (ADS-B): ADS-B enhances situational awareness and safety by providing real-time aircraft position and other data to air traffic controllers and neighboring aircraft.
- Data Communications (Data Comm): Data Comm enables secure and reliable exchange of text and digital information between aircraft and ground systems, improving communication and coordination.
- NextGen Weather: This initiative utilizes advanced weather prediction and monitoring tools to enhance weather information dissemination, allowing pilots to make informed decisions during flight planning and operations.
- Collaborative Decision Making (CDM): CDM promotes information sharing and coordination among airspace users, including airlines, airports, and air traffic controllers, to optimize air traffic flow and reduce delays.
These initiatives are part of a comprehensive effort to modernize the national airspace system and ensure its readiness for the anticipated growth in air traffic demand in the coming years.
Redefining Airspace Management
2025 initiatives also include significant changes in airspace management strategies. The goal is to create a more efficient and flexible system that can accommodate the increasing number of aircraft and optimize the use of airspace. Key elements of these changes include:
- Dynamic Airspace Management: This approach allows airspace boundaries to be adjusted in real-time to accommodate traffic flow changes, improving capacity and reducing congestion.
- Intersection deconfliction: Advanced surveillance systems enable air traffic controllers to detect and resolve potential conflicts at intersections, enhancing safety and reducing delays.
- Optimized approaches and departures: New arrival and departure procedures are being developed to minimize delays and environmental impact, while also improving safety.
Technology Advancements Driving Innovation
The success of 2025 initiatives relies heavily on the advancement and integration of innovative technologies, including:
- Unmanned Aircraft Systems (UAS): UAS integration into the national airspace system holds the potential to improve efficiency, facilitate new applications, and enhance safety.
- Satellite-Based Augmentation Systems (SBAS): SBAS enhances the accuracy and integrity of GPS signals, enabling more precise navigation and approach procedures.
-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I technologies can assist air traffic controllers in making informed decisions, optimizing traffic flow, and improving safety.
The combination of these advancements and initiatives promises to revolutionize the national airspace system, enhancing safety, increasing capacity, and reducing environmental impact.
